Defalcate
verb
[ˈdɛfəɫkeɪt]
Word Frequency:
0.0
Definitions
1.
verb
To misappropriate funds; to embezzle.
2.
verb
To cut off; to take away or deduct a part of (money, rents, income, etc.).
